Output dd906f0c86ddfceb7fee5cfbeac41aecd5d5d25cbd9d1ecbdd3ba75d9e100af3:1

value
175134
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4af3064a2ad822c8a104f028e97ad26460068835 OP_EQUAL
address
38XK4P8Jf6aWZn89ZzHZtdAg4sH8g2oRHL
transaction
dd906f0c86ddfceb7fee5cfbeac41aecd5d5d25cbd9d1ecbdd3ba75d9e100af3
spent
true